Abstract

The present invention describes therapeutic compositions comprising fibroblasts that have been stimulated to increase expression of extracellular matrix components or elastin, or to produce enhanced elastogenesis or the appearance thereof at a site of administration. The therapeutic fibroblast formulations can be prepared using a variety of elastogenic agents, including digests of mammalian elastin, chemically digested plant extracts comprising elastin-like peptides, and synthetic elastogenic peptides. The invention further comprises cosmetic and pharmaceutical treatment methods using the therapeutic fibroblast compositions of the invention.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A therapeutic composition for stimulating elastogenesis or the appearance thereof comprising a therapeutically effective amount of a population of cultured dermal fibroblasts, wherein said population of cultured dermal fibroblasts is pretreated with an elastogenic composition. 
     
     
         2 . The therapeutic composition of  claim 1  wherein said population of cultured dermal fibroblasts is derived from a skin biopsy. 
     
     
         3 . The therapeutic composition of  claim 2  wherein said skin biopsy comprises cells of a stratum basale layer. 
     
     
         4 . The therapeutic composition of  claim 1 , wherein said elastogenic composition comprises at least one of ProK-60, E91, or ProK-60P. 
     
     
         5 . The therapeutic composition of  claim 1  wherein said elastogenic composition comprises a peptide having a sequence GXXPG (SEQ ID NO. 2), wherein X represents any of the natural amino acids. 
     
     
         6 . The therapeutic composition of  claim 1  wherein said elastogenic composition comprises a peptide having a sequence PGGVLPG (SEQ ID NO. 47), VGVVPG (SEQ ID NO. 48), or IGLGPGGV (SEQ ID NO. 49). 
     
     
         7 . The therapeutic composition of  claim 1  wherein said elastogenic composition comprises a peptide having a sequence VGAMPG (SEQ ID NO. 51), VGLSPG (SEQ ID NO. 52), IGAMPG (SEQ ID NO. 54), IGVAPG (SEQ ID NO. 55), IGLSPG (SEQ ID NO. 56), VGAMPGAAAAAVGAMPG (SEQ ID NO. 58), VGLSPGAAAAAVGLSPG (SEQ ID NO. 59), VGVAPGAAAAAVGVAPG (SEQ ID NO 60) IGAMPGAAAAAIGAMPG (SEQ ID NO. 61), IGLSPGAAAAAIGLSPG (SEQ ID NO. 63), or IGVAPGAAAAAIGVAPG (SEQ ID NO. 62). 
     
     
         8 . The therapeutic composition of  claim 1  wherein said elastogenic composition comprises a compound obtained or derived from a plant. 
     
     
         9 . The therapeutic composition of  claim 1  wherein said elastogenic composition comprises a compound obtained or derived from rice bran. 
     
     
         10 . A method for improving appearance or elasticity of a tissue comprising: administering to a mammal in need thereof an effective amount of a composition comprising a population of cultured dermal fibroblasts, wherein said population of cultured dermal fibroblasts is pretreated with an elastogenic composition. 
     
     
         11 . The method of  claim 10 , wherein said elastogenic composition comprises a compound selected from ProK-60, E91, and ProK-60P. 
     
     
         12 . The method of  claim 10  wherein said elastogenic composition comprises a peptide having a sequence GXXPG (SEQ ID NO. 2), wherein X represents any of the natural amino acids. 
     
     
         13 . The method of  claim 10  wherein said elastogenic composition comprises a peptide having a sequence PGGVLPG (SEQ ID NO. 47), VGVVPG (SEQ ID NO. 48), or IGLGPGGV (SEQ ID NO. 49). 
     
     
         14 . The method of  claim 10 , wherein said elastogenic composition comprises a peptide having a sequence VGAMPG (SEQ ID NO. 51), VGLSPG (SEQ ID NO. 52), IGAMPG (SEQ ID NO. 54), IGVAPG (SEQ ID NO. 55), IGLSPG (SEQ ID NO. 56), VGAMPGAAAAAVGAMPG (SEQ ID NO. 58), VGLSPGAAAAAVGLSPG (SEQ ID NO. 59), VGVAPGAAAAAVGVAPG (SEQ ID NO 60) IGAMPGAAAAAIGAMPG (SEQ ID NO. 61), IGLSPGAAAAAIGLSPG (SEQ ID NO. 63), or IGVAPGAAAAAIGVAPG (SEQ ID NO. 62). 
     
     
         15 . The method of  claim 10  wherein said elastogenic composition is obtained or derived from a plant. 
     
     
         16 . The method of  claim 10  wherein said elastogenic composition is obtained or derived from rice bran. 
     
     
         17 . The method of  claim 10 , wherein said composition is administered by injection. 
     
     
         18 . The method of  claim 10 , wherein said composition stimulates elastogenesis at the site of administration. 
     
     
         19 . The method of  claim 10 , wherein said composition improves the appearance of visible lines or wrinkles. 
     
     
         20 . The method of  claim 10 , wherein said composition improves the appearance of scar tissue. 
     
     
         21 . A method for stimulating new blood vessel formation in a tissue comprising: administering to a mammal in need thereof an effective amount of a composition comprising a population of cultured dermal fibroblasts, wherein said population of cultured dermal fibroblasts is pretreated with an elastin digest preparation. 
     
     
         22 . The method of  claim 21  wherein said administration is by injection. 
     
     
         23 . The method of  claim 21  wherein said administration is performed in preparation for plastic surgery.
